I/O System
An Input/Output System is the component of a computer or PLC responsible for communication with the external environment through devices like sensors and actuators.
CPU
A CPU, or Central Processing Unit, is the primary component of a computer responsible for interpreting and executing instructions and running software.
Field Equipment
Hardware and devices deployed in outdoor or remote areas for monitoring, controlling, or communication purposes in various industries.
PLC's Operating System
The software framework that manages the hardware resources of a Programmable Logic Controller and provides the execution environment for the control program.
